Action item (P1, owner: platform): After the Brindlewood wiki incident, role-cache staleness let revoked editors write for up to an hour. Shorten the cache TTL, cap concurrent permission re-checks, and add a hard revocation sweep interval. Ship behind the `rbac_fastpath` flag in the next release train; do not hotfix production directly. Verify against the audit replay before promotion. The agreed values for the new constants are listed below.

limits module of yahif-tawif:
BUDGETS = {
    "ulays": 902,
    "kelael": 492,
    "ralix": 488,
    "oliok": 420,
    "wenmir": 757,
    "casath": 178,
    "eliir": 272,
}

### Step 4 — Enable hot reload

Remove the restart hook from the deploy script; Corvath now watches its config file and applies changes in place. Reviewers: reject any PR that still bundles config changes with a process restart. Reload failures log a diff and keep the old values active. Verify the watcher flags match the values below.

deployment values, kajep-kageg:
[praix]
host = praix.paliqcorp.corp
user = praix_svc
database = praix_prod

### Consent banner (Larchgate rollout)

The banner ships from the Larchgate config service, not the app bundle. Never hardcode consent copy. Regional variants are keyed by locale; legal must sign off on any text change. Rollbacks take effect within five minutes. Rollout history, flags, and the approval workflow are documented here.

wiki page, tahaf-tajog: https://jira.ordindyn.corp/pipeline